Because I am skeptical of these 'it wasn't me' claims, I would be thanking the buyer for the information, opening an Unpaid Item Dispute (heidi gives the method above) and recovering my fees. You have up to 32 days to do this.
The further advantages of this are that the bidder, who lets just anyone use her account, gets a Strike for non-payment,which may restrict her ability to bid on eBay in future. In addition, she cannot leave feedback for you.
You can set your Seller Preferences to Block bidders with Strikes for non-payment. It is also useful to set a Preference that will Block bidders who do not have active Paypal accounts. If you were using Fixed Price listings, you can also require Immediate Payment.
